SoFi stock dives 6% as Wall Street wobbles — then a top executive buys shares

SoFi Technologies shares fell 6.2% to $19.46 on heavy volume after a broad U.S. market sell-off. Executive Eric Schuppenhauer disclosed buying 5,000 shares at $19.93, according to an SEC filing. Investors are watching interest rates and a delayed U.S. jobs report for signals on consumer-credit stocks. SoFi’s trading volume topped 87 million shares, far above average.

Super Micro (SMCI) stock slides 9% after earnings spike — what to watch before Friday’s trade

Super Micro Computer shares fell 8.6% to $30.85 Thursday, reversing Wednesday’s surge after the company raised its 2026 sales forecast to $40 billion but reported sharply lower margins. Gross margin dropped to 6.3% last quarter as net sales rose to $12.7 billion. Trading volume more than doubled its 50-day average. Other AI hardware stocks, including Nvidia and AMD, also declined.

CoreWeave stock price sinks 9% as CRWV traders weigh ARENA launch and Feb. 26 earnings

CoreWeave shares fell 9.5% Thursday to $74.65, with nearly 23.6 million shares traded. The drop came as the company launched CoreWeave ARENA, a lab for testing production-scale AI workloads. Investors await fourth-quarter results on Feb. 26 and face a March 13 deadline to join a securities class action. Nvidia recently invested $2 billion in CoreWeave at $87.20 per share.

Citigroup stock price slips after Wall Street selloff; Citi’s preferred redemption and Trump Accounts match in focus

Citigroup shares fell 1.5% to $115.74 Thursday, with little change after hours and trading volume above average. The bank said it will redeem $2.3 billion in Series X preferred shares on Feb. 18 at $1,000 each, and will match the U.S. government’s $1,000 “Trump Account” deposits for eligible employee families starting July 4. Wall Street ended lower, led by declines in tech stocks.

Walmart pharmacy technician pay push shows up on job boards as new team-lead roles roll out

Walmart posted new pharmacy job listings Thursday, showing pay for team leads in Norman, Oklahoma, at $21–$34 an hour and certified technicians in Vernal, Utah, at $21–$26. The company recently upgraded 3,000 positions to team lead roles, with average pay around $28 and some reaching $42. Salary ranges vary by location and certification. The updates come as Walmart expands pharmacy services and roles amid rising walk-in care demand.

AbbVie stock ticks higher after hours as traders digest 2026 outlook after Rinvoq miss

AbbVie shares rose 0.7% to $219.02 in after-hours trading Thursday, rebounding after a nearly 6% drop following its earnings report. Skyrizi beat sales estimates with $5.01 billion, while Rinvoq missed at $2.37 billion. The company raised its 2026 forecast for the pair to $31.6 billion. Investors remain focused on whether new drugs can offset Humira’s ongoing decline.

Why Intuit stock slid Thursday — then edged up after hours on a fresh ChatGPT rollout

Intuit shares closed down 2.4% at $434.91 Thursday, then rose 0.5% in after-hours trading after the company announced its TurboTax, Credit Karma, QuickBooks, and Mailchimp apps are now live inside ChatGPT. The stock move came as software shares faced pressure on fears that AI could disrupt business models. Intuit will report fiscal Q2 earnings on Feb. 26.

CrowdStrike stock sinks on insider sale plan as ‘software-mageddon’ rout bites CRWD

CrowdStrike shares fell 9.2% to $377.16 in after-hours trading Thursday after a Form 144 filing signaled a possible sale of 252,538 shares via J.P. Morgan. The drop followed a broader selloff in U.S. software stocks amid renewed concerns over AI disruption. The filing showed the PK Giving Trust may sell shares valued at about $104.9 million. CrowdStrike also announced a memorandum of understanding with Saudi Aramco.

  • World Shares Mixed as UAE Quits OPEC; Oil Prices Surge Over 3%
    April 29, 2026, 7:46 AM EDT. Global markets showed mixed performance Wednesday after Wall Street losses, while oil prices surged over 3% following the UAE's announcement it will exit OPEC, impacting 40% of global oil output. Brent crude rose to $114.70 a barrel, reflecting uncertainty over the Iran war and disrupted supplies through the Strait of Hormuz, a key oil transit route. The Federal Reserve is expected to hold interest rates at 3.6%, continuing efforts to balance inflation and economic growth. European indices slipped, with Britain's FTSE 100 down 0.6% and Germany's DAX down 0.3%. Asian markets were split; South Korea's Kospi gained 0.8% while Taiwan's Taiex fell 0.6%. Analysts note UAE's departure could boost production but hinges on geopolitical stability in the Persian Gulf.

SoFi Stock Gets Its Q1 Verdict: Record Revenue, Bigger Loans, One Weak Spot

29 April 2026
SoFi Technologies reported first-quarter adjusted net revenue up 41% to $1.087 billion, beating estimates, with net income more than doubling to $166.7 million. Lending originations jumped 68% to $12.18 billion, while deposits rose to $40.2 billion. Technology Platform revenue dropped 27% after a major client exit. SoFi began minting SoFiUSD, a dollar-backed stablecoin, and expanded digital asset efforts.
